Some separators missing in main window
Moderators: Hacker, petermad, Stefan2, white
Some separators missing in main window
(split from other thread where it shouldn't have been in the first place ;)
Image: http://web.hisoftware.cz/sob/img/tc80b1-visual-bugs.png
Only 32-bit version with classic theme has it correct. Different button separators are cut off in others. Image name says beta 1, but it's the same for 2 and 3.
Image: http://web.hisoftware.cz/sob/img/tc80b1-visual-bugs.png
Only 32-bit version with classic theme has it correct. Different button separators are cut off in others. Image name says beta 1, but it's the same for 2 and 3.
Last edited by Sob on 2011-10-01, 12:49 UTC, edited 1 time in total.
- Vochomurka
- Power Member
- Posts: 816
- Joined: 2005-09-14, 22:19 UTC
- Location: Russia
- Contact:
What are your settings in Configuration\Layout: "Flat icons" and "Flat user interface..."?
Single user license #329241
PowerPro scripts for Total Commander
PowerPro scripts for Total Commander
- Vochomurka
- Power Member
- Posts: 816
- Joined: 2005-09-14, 22:19 UTC
- Location: Russia
- Contact:
Yes, I confirm. But why do you think that this behaviour is "incorrect"? It is just the interface peculiarity.
Single user license #329241
PowerPro scripts for Total Commander
PowerPro scripts for Total Commander
Confirm too under XP x64, Luna theme.
Flint's Homepage: Full TC Russification Package, VirtualDisk, NTFS Links, NoClose Replacer, and other stuff!
Using TC 11.03 / Win10 x64
Using TC 11.03 / Win10 x64
It doesn't really look to be by design, does it? I'd buy differences between Classic and Aero themes, but then I'd expect it to be the same for both 32 and 64-bit versions. And one more reason, the button is cut when the mouse is above it (see the updated screenshot in the first post). This can't be intentional. :)Vochomurka wrote:But why do you think that this behaviour is "incorrect"?
- ghisler(Author)
- Site Admin
- Posts: 50479
- Joined: 2003-02-04, 09:46 UTC
- Location: Switzerland
- Contact:
I can confirm that the separator on the left wasn't drawn. It's a lazarus problem: I was setting a color for the "brush" object, but the object was set to transparent. Delphi changes this automatically to opaque when setting a color, Lazarus doesn't.
Author of Total Commander
https://www.ghisler.com
https://www.ghisler.com
The separator is now drawn in 8.0β4. So, fixed.
Flint's Homepage: Full TC Russification Package, VirtualDisk, NTFS Links, NoClose Replacer, and other stuff!
Using TC 11.03 / Win10 x64
Using TC 11.03 / Win10 x64
Almost, just few details (not that I think it's too important, but since I reported it and can see it, so lets say "for the record"):
Win7 x64, classic theme, TC x64:
1)
- run TC with clean ini
- separator between directory hotlist and history buttons is present
- Ctrl+T for new tab and separator is gone
2)
- run TC with clean ini
- separator between go to drive root and go one level up is present
- disable Flat user interface
- enable Flat user interface
- both separators between buttons are gone
3) (also for 32-bit TC)
- run TC with clean ini
- go to drive root button is still either cut-off one pixel on the left or overlaps with left separator by one pixel (see updated image in the first post)
Win7 x64, classic theme, TC x64:
1)
- run TC with clean ini
- separator between directory hotlist and history buttons is present
- Ctrl+T for new tab and separator is gone
2)
- run TC with clean ini
- separator between go to drive root and go one level up is present
- disable Flat user interface
- enable Flat user interface
- both separators between buttons are gone
3) (also for 32-bit TC)
- run TC with clean ini
- go to drive root button is still either cut-off one pixel on the left or overlaps with left separator by one pixel (see updated image in the first post)
- ghisler(Author)
- Site Admin
- Posts: 50479
- Joined: 2003-02-04, 09:46 UTC
- Location: Switzerland
- Contact:
- ghisler(Author)
- Site Admin
- Posts: 50479
- Joined: 2003-02-04, 09:46 UTC
- Location: Switzerland
- Contact: